Priyanka Chopra admits being hurt by conspiracy theories around marriage to Nick Jonas; recalls marrying within six months of meeting

Priyanka Chopra has once again addressed the persistent conspiracy theories surrounding her marriage to Nick Jonas. In a recent conversation, the actress spoke about the speculation, the age-gap chatter, and marrying within six months of meeting — making it clear that the outside noise no longer affects her.

“I don’t know what about us rubbed people the wrong way”

Ever since Priyanka and Nick tied the knot in 2018, their relationship has been under constant scrutiny — from their 10-year age gap to their intercultural wedding. Reacting to rumours predicting their split, Priyanka told Variety, “We’re eight years in. If people want to keep waiting for it to implode, that’s their choice. I stopped thinking about it.”She admitted that the commentary was initially painful. “I don’t know what was it about us that rubbed people the wrong way. I think there was the intercultural nature of it — different countries, different religions, age gap. It was very hurtful.”However, the couple chose to turn inward rather than react publicly. “And we both, instead of looking out, just sort of looked at each other, and we were like, ‘It doesn’t matter.’ So it’s like water off a duck’s back now,” she added.

On marrying within six months: “I didn’t know if it was even real”

Priyanka also spoke about how quickly their relationship moved. The couple got married in Rajasthan when she was 36 and Nick was 26 — within six months of meeting.“We got married really quick, within six months of meeting. When I first married him, I didn’t know if it was even real. This part of him. Because I was like this is crazy. This is put on,” she confessed.

But what convinced her otherwise was Nick’s unwavering authenticity. “Nick has this absolute sincerity. It inspires me every day in a profession which requires you to pivot and become whatever you need to put on. He’s constantly sincere. His whole day, whatever the conversation is, he is sincere.”She further credited his upbringing for shaping that quality. “He started working when he was really young. His parents are the most wonderful, levelheaded, absolute saints, so I can see where it comes from. But it’s such a disarming quality about him.” Priyanka and Nick, who had both a Christian and Hindu wedding ceremony in Rajasthan, welcomed their daughter, Malti Marie Chopra Jonas, in January 2022.
